the ratio of the sides of a certain triangle is 2:7:8 if the longest side of the triangle is 40cm how long are the other two sid
Zigmanuir [339]

The length of the other two sides is 10 and 35 respectively.

<h3>What is a ratio?</h3>

A ratio is a quantitative relation showing the comparison between two or more numbers. It can also be written in the fractional form where the first part is the numerator and the second part is called the denominator.

From the given information:

  • The sides of the triangle = 2:7:8
  • The total sides of the triangle = 2+7+8 = 17

We are being told that the longest side is the triangle is equal to 40.

i.e.

\mathbf{\to\dfrac{8}{17}\times x = 40}

\mathbf{x = 40 \div \dfrac{8}{17}}

\mathbf{x = 40 \times \dfrac{17}{8}}

x = 85

Now for the other two sides 2 and 7, their length is as follows.

\mathbf{\dfrac{2}{17}\times 85 = 10}

\mathbf{\dfrac{7}{17}\times 85 = 35}

Therefore, we can conclude that the length of the other two sides is 10 and 35 respectively.
